Victoria “Vicki” Readings is a UK-based counselling therapist with five years of professional experience. She is Adlerian trained, which means she pays close attention to lifestyle, family environment, childhood experiences and memories and how these elements influence adult life.
Her therapeutic approach draws on a range of methods, including person-centred talking therapy alongside creative and metaphorical techniques such as drawing-and-talking and phototherapy. She tailors interventions to each person, helping clients explore, express and deepen their self-understanding while feeling supported throughout the therapeutic process.
Victoria also integrates holistic practices - yoga, laughter yoga and mindfulness - into her work when appropriate, offering a rounded way to support stress, anxiety and low mood alongside conventional counselling techniques. Her stated specialties include stress, anxiety, family work, parenting support, self-esteem and coping with life changes, and she practises as a female therapist.
Her experience covers anxiety, stress, depression, family dynamics, relationships, self-understanding and exploring life goals. She also has experience of military life, which informs her understanding when working with people who serve, have family members in the military or are part of military families.
With a background in education, Victoria is able to work with children and adolescents as well as adults, taking a holistic view that considers emotional, psychological and social needs. She aims to encourage and empower clients to develop coping strategies, increase awareness of self and progress toward their goals.
